How to Back Up the Windows Registry

When your computer becomes slow, one of the first things you should do is scan your Windows registry for errors and obsolete entries. Cleaning the registry with a registry cleaner and removing outdated and empty entries from the registry can make your computer a lot faster. In addition to that, there are advanced registry tweaks that can really boost the performance of your PC. However, if registry cleanup and tweaks are performed incorrectly, they can damage your computer so that you will need to reinstall the operating system. That’s why you should always back up the registry before performing cleanup, registry defrag, and tweaking.

There are several ways to back up the Windows registry. Here are the most effective backup methods.

1. Create a System Restore Point

Creating a system restore point is one of the best ways to not only back up the registry, but to ask back up your computer so that you can roll back changes if any of them cause harm. System restore returns your computer to a previous date without deleting your recent files, emails or program settings. Remember that a system restore doesn’t actually back up your files, but it does create a reliable registry backup.

To create a restore point, do the following:

1.    Go to StartAll ProgramsAccessoriesSystem ToolsSystem Restore
2.    Click Create a restore point, then click Next
3.    In the Restore point description text box name the restore point, so that you can easily find it in case you need it
4.    Click Create

2. Export a Selected Branch of the Registry

This backup method is more reliable than creating a system restore point. In addition to that, it needs less disk space because only the selected registry branch is backed up. This method is preferred if you are changing a particular registry key.
Here is how you can export a registry branch:

1.    Click StartRun
2.    Type regedit in the box and click OK
3.    Find  the registry key you are going to edit and click on it
4.    Go to the File menu and click Export
5.    Select where you want to save the file
6.    Name the file and click Save

Now you can restore the backed up registry key if something goes wrong when you are editing registry values. To revert the changes you’ve made, simply double-click on the backup file and the settings stored in it will be added to the registry.

How To Fix The 80004005 Error

The 80004005 error occurs when you try to use ActiveX Data Objects (ADO) or ODBC to connect to a Microsoft Access database. The error you may receive will look something like this:

“The Microsoft Jet Database Engine cannot open the file ‘(unknown)’”

or

“Microsoft OLE DB Provider for ODBC Drivers error ’80004005′
[Microsoft][ODBC Microsoft Access 97 Driver] The Microsoft Jet database engine cannot open the file ‘(unknown)’. It is already opened exclusively by another user, or you need permission to view its data.”

What Causes The 80004005 Error

There are several causes of the 80004005 error, some of which include:

  • The account that Microsoft Internet Information Server (IIS) is using (which is usually IUSR) does not have the correct Windows NT permissions for a file-based database or for the folder that contains the file.
  • The file and the data source name are marked as Exclusive.
  • Another process or user has the Access database open.

How To Fix The 80004005 Error

Step 1 - Check The Permissions On The File

It is recommended that you check the permissions on the file and the folder. Make sure that you have the ability to create and/or destroy any temporary files. Temporary files are usually created in the same folder as the database, but the file may also be created in other folders such as the WINNT folder.

Step 2 - Verify The File And Data Source

It is important to verify the file and data source because the file has to be in proper working order and must be protected from damage or corrupt. Other wise your computer will experience some difficulty trying to use the correct files.

Step 3 - Close Any Visual InterDev Projects

It is recommended that you close down any other Visual InterDev projects that contain a data connection to the database. This way your computer won’t be confused and will be able to work properly.

Rtvscan.exe Error Fixes Tutorial

The Rtvscan.exe file is a part of the Norton Antivirus program. Errors in this file are typically caused by you not having the latest DirectX version in your PC. This is most likely because you have failed to update your version of Direct X. If it’s out of date, then certain programs, including Norton Antivirus, may not be able to run properly. The following message will be displayed on your computer when you have this error:

  • “Rtvscan.exe – Application Error: The instruction at “0x77fcc8e1″ referenced memory at 0×00000000. The memory could not be written or read. Click OK to terminate the program, or cancel to debug the program.”

What Causes RTVScan.exe Errors?

You will typically experience errors with the rtvscan.exe when you are running an outdated DirectX version (normally older than DirectX 8.1) in your system, which makes your PC use too much RAM and memory, which is what leads to this particular error. Otherwise, the error may be caused by faulty registry settings. You need to solve any issues that are causing the error. This tutorial will teach you how you can repair these issues in your PC.

How To Fix RTVScan.exe Errors

Step 1 – Update The DirectX Version On Your PC

The first thing that you need to do when you have this error in your computer is to update the DirectX version in your system.  To do this, first click on Start then choose All Programs,. Next, select Windows Update. Afterwards choose Custom updates and then view any entries in the “Optional Software” field.   When you see the DirectX updates appear on your screen, install them.

Step 2 – Rename The “SoftwareDistribution” Folder Of Your PC

Another way to resolve this error in your PC is to rename the SoftwareDistribution folder in your system. The steps for doing this are explained below.

  • Log-on to your PC as an administrator
  • Click on Start then choose All Programs
  • Next select Accessories
  • Right click Command Prompt then choose “Run as administrator
  • Type “net stop WuAuServ” in the “Administrator: Command Prompt” window then press Enter
  • Again click on the Start button then type “%windir%” in the Start Search box. Next, press Enter
  • Locate the “SoftwareDistribution” folder in the opened folder
  • Right click on the folder, then choose Rename
  • Rename the folder by typing “SDold
  • Restart the Windows Updates service in your PC by typing “net start WuAuServ” in the opened window.

Step 3 – Re-Install Programs Causing The Error

One other likely reason as to why this error will surface on your PC is due to Windows’ failure to process some of the files and settings in a problematic program.  For this matter, you need to remove the “guilty” application or applications from your computer to restore normalcy inside your system.  To accomplish this, follow the steps that are outlined below:

  • First click on Start afterwards choose Control Panel
  • Next select Add/Remove Programs
  • From a list that will be displayed on your screen, locate the “guilty” application then click on the Uninstall tab
  • If an uninstall wizard pop-ups on your screen, follow the steps that it will display.
  • You can now restart your PC to refresh the settings in your system
  • Reinstall the program on your computer by inserting the CD installer on your CD/DVD drive
  • Finally, test the application and see if it is working properly

How To Resolve Runtime Error 429

Runtime Error 429 is a problem that is reported to occur on many Windows systems recently, and it usually indicates there is an issue somewhere in the automation in your Microsoft Office applications.  The error typically shows up when you try to automate Office application files using Visual Basic macros.  The error is caused by the Windows Component Object Model (COM) being unable to create the requested automation object.  You need to resolve the issues surrounding COM to be able to automate Microsoft applications successfully.  This tutorial will help you resolve runtime error 429 easily.

What Causes Runtime Error 429?

Runtime error code 429 is most often caused by one of the following issues:

  • There is a mistake in the application.
  • There is a mistake in the system configuration.
  • A component is missing.
  • A  component is damaged.

Alternatively, the error can also be caused by problems inside the Windows registry.  You need to identify exactly what the source of the problem is, and then fix it efficiently – which can be done by performing the steps described below:

How To Fix Runtime Error 429

Step1 – Make Sure That Macros Can Be Used In The Program

To resolve the error, the first thing you need to do is ensure that your application is able to work with automation. Sometimes you will find that Microsoft Office doesn’t have Macros enabled. If this is the case, then this is the likely reason you are seeing error. To verify if your application is compatible with automation, simply follow these simple steps:

  • Click Start > Run.
  • Type the name of the application.  For example, type “Word” to troubleshoot Microsoft Word.
  • Press OK.

Step 2 - Register The Application Again

You also need to make sure the application is properly registered. Re-registering the application will enable the automation server to process the application correctly. If it is not registered with the automation server, the error will occur. You re-register the application by following these steps:

  • Click Start > Run.
  • Type “C:\Program Files\Microsoft Office\Office\Word.exe/regserver” and press Enter.
  • If MS Word is located in a different path, type the correct path with Word.exe/regserver at the end, and press Enter.

Step 3 – Rename Vital Word Files (Normal.dot World.xml)

This step is essential as there are times when Runtime Error 429 can occur due to the failing of automation, which is down to the Normal.dot template or the Word.xml file becoming damaged.  You need to rename vital Word files to resolve this issue, which you can do by following these simple steps:

  • Locate all Normal.dot and Word.xml files on your system by using the search function.
  • Rename each file included in the search results.
  • Run your automation test again to see if it runs.  If the issue has been resolved, it means the deleted files will be recreated along with their application.
  • However, if this is not the case, then rename the files back to their original names to re-use them.

How To Resolve System Error 5 – “Access Is Denied”

System Error 5 is a common Windows error that typically announces itself with the “Access Is Denied” error message, indicating that there is a problem with your “NetView” or “Net Time” commands.   The problem is generally caused by conflicts with the time displayed on your system, or else by corrupted account information.  You need to resolve the issues causing this error to stop these messages from showing up.  This tutorial will help you resolve the system error 5 on your PC.

What Causes System Error 5?

When you encounter the Windows error 5, one of the following messages will be displayed:

  • “System Error 5 has occurred”
  • “Access is denied”

The error can be caused by numerous different issues with your computer, though the most likely cause is that permission has not been granted to local users by the Windows Vista User Account Control function. Known as the UAC, this is responsible for controlling information about the system for each user account, and so it is critical that it is working properly so that you can get rid of errors on your computer.

There are several other possible causes of Windows error 5, include a problem with time synchronization, lack of user permissions, conflicts with firewalls or third party products or an error with the Active Directory.

How To Fix Windows Error 5:

Step 1 – Ensure The Time Settings Of Windows Are Correct

To eliminate time synchronization problems, you need to ensure that the time settings of your PC are correct.  You can correct the time settings in one of two ways.  You can click on the time in the system tray, which is located at the lower right portion of your screen, and click “Change date and time settings”, or you can click Start > Control Panel > Date and Time.  If the problem is due to a different time zone, click the “Change time zone” button and select the proper time zone from there.  If you simply need to correct the time, click the “Change date and time” button and synchronize the time from there.

Step 2 – Clean Out Any Viruses From Your PC

The error can easily be caused by a virus infection that creates conflicts in your system.  You need to eliminate possible viruses that are causing trouble within your system by using a powerful “anti-malware” application, such as XoftSpy, which is able to remove all instances of malicious software in your hard drive.  This process will not only resolve the problem, but will also help protect your system from future malware infection.

Step 3 – Correct Corrupted Registry Keys

The problem can also be resolved by manually correcting corrupted registry keys, specifically the ‘LocalAccountTokenFilterPolicy’ registry key that is present in Windows Vista and XP operating systems.  You need to ensure that your system gains full credentials.  Follow these steps:

  1. Click Start > Run and type “regedit” in the open box, then hit Enter.
  2. Supply the administrator password if prompted to continue, or simply click Continue to confirm.
  3. Check the left pane in the registry editor window and search for the following registry key: “H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\
    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Policies\System
  4. If you cannot find ‘LocalAccountTokenFilterPolicy’ in this registry key, then you need to add it and reset its value:
  • Access the Edit menu and click New > DWORD VALUE.
  • Name it “LocalAccountTokenFilterPolicy” and then click OK.
  • Right-click on the LocalAccountTokenFilterPolicy key and click Modify.
  • Provide a value of “1” in the Value Data box and click OK.
  1. Exit the registry and reboot your PC for the changes to take effect.

Windows 1719 Error Resolution – How To Cure Windows 1719 Errors

Windows 1719 Error occurs when people have a problem accessing the Windows Installer service.  The error typically appears when you are attempting to install or uninstall a program which can include Windows Update and other Microsoft programs.  The actual file affected is “MSIEXEC.EXE” which can either be corrupted or missing.  You need to resolve the issues with the file to be able to install or uninstall programs successfully.  This tutorial will help you cure Windows 1719 errors.

What Causes The 1719 Error?

The various 1719 errors are primarily caused by faulty Windows Installer as a result of damaged or corrupted settings, and missing installation files which prevent Windows from properly using the Windows Installer service.  The error also appears when you are attempting to install software such as Microsoft Office that uses the “.msi” (Microsoft Software Installer) package extension.  The problems can also be caused by errors inside the registry.  You need to repair the errors in order to fix the problem – which can be accomplished using the steps outlined below:

How To Fix Error 1719

Step 1 – Re-Register Windows Installer

In most cases, the problem can be fixed by re-registering the msiexec.exe onto your system.  You can easily re-register the Windows Installer by following these steps:

  • Click Start> Run, and type “cmd” in the dialogue box that appears, and click OK or press Enter.
  • In the Command Prompt window, “msiexec /unreg” and press Enter.
  • Next, typemsiexec /regserverand then press Enter. If you have a 64-bit version of Windows 7, run this command insteadC:\Windows\syswow64\Msiexec /regserver” and press Enter to re-register the file.
  • Finally, reboot your computer for the changes to take effect.

Step 2 – Re-Install Windows Installer

Re-installing Windows Installer can also cure the Windows 1719 errors.  You first need to rename files that have become corrupted and then proceed with the installation of the Windows Installer.  Follow these steps:

  1. Click Start> Run, and type “cmd” and then press Enter.
  2. In the Command Prompt window, type the following commands and press Enter after each of them:

cd %windir%\system32attrib -r -s -h dllcache

ren msi.dll msi.bak

ren msiexec.exe msiexec.bak

ren msihnd.dll msihnd.bak

exit

  1. Reboot your PC.
  2. After logging in Windows, download the latest Microsoft Windows Installer from the Microsoft website and install it on your system.

How To Make Windows 7 Boot Up In Seconds – Tricks The Experts Use

The more we use our computers, the more we tend to accumulate lots of programs.  When you have dozens of installed programs that load up together with Windows during startup, the boot process takes longer, especially if those programs use up heavy resources.  Over time, some settings inside your registry will also become damaged or corrupted, causing problems that can confuse Windows and take up more time in completing tasks during the startup stage.

How To Make Your PC Boot Up Faster

There are various ways to make your PC finish the boot process faster.  Windows 7 is designed to run and boot fast when working properly.  You can try doing these things:

  • Remove programs in the startup list
  • Disable Windows features such as Search Indexing, Sidebar and Aero Theme
  • Disable unwanted visual effects and services
  • Remove the User Account control feature

The best way to make your PC boot up faster is to remove errors in your registry by using a registry cleaner application.  However, there are also some secrets that you can employ to boost the loading time of Windows 7.

Ways To Make Windows 7 Boot Up In Seconds

Step 1 – Uninstall Any Programs You Don’t Need On Your PC

There are many programs that are configured to startup when Windows loads.  This will increase the loading time of Windows as it will only complete the boot process when it has successfully loaded all programs included in the startup list.  The first thing that you need to do is uninstall programs that you don’t use anymore, especially if it’s an application that is heavy on resources.  It is highly recommended that you remove them from your system. Do so by clicking Start> Control Panel> Programs and Features and select the program from among the list, and finally, click the “Uninstall” button.  This process will remove software that increases the boot time.

Step 2 – Remove Any Junk Files From Your System

Your system continually accumulates files as you use it, and many of these files are considered to be junk, such as temporary internet files, which you should remove from time to time.  When your PC has not been maintained regularly enough, those junk files can cause Windows to slow down while it works, especially in the boot process.  You need to remove the junk files from your system, including stuff that you have downloaded, deleted items that are still lying in the Recycle Bin, etc.  Here’s how to do this:

  1. Click on Start> All Programs> Accessories> System Tools> Disk Cleanup.
  2. Select the drive you want to clean up and click OK.
  3. After Windows is done calculating how much disk space will be gained through completing Disk Cleanup, in the Disk Cleanup for window, tick the check boxes on the left of the items you want to be deleted, and then click OK.
  4. Click on the Delete Files button.

You can also delete unnecessary system files by clicking the Clean up system files in the Disk Cleanup for window and do the same steps for those files that you want to be included in the Disk Cleanup operation.  This process will free up disk space which can give Windows breathing room.  You can also delete any other unnecessary files that are lying around in your system.
